CVE-2022-24990 — TerraMaster OS Remote Command Execution Vulnerability

TerraMaster NAS 4.2.29 and earlier allows remote attackers to discover the administrative password by sending "User-Agent: TNAS" to module/api.php?mobile/webNasIPS and then reading the PWD field in the response.

03Active exploitation status

Yes — actively exploited. Added to the CISA KEV catalog on 2023-02-10. Ransomware use: Known.
